James Madison’s ‘Notes’: Revising the Constitutional Convention with Mary Sarah Bilder

December 15, 2015

Michael J. Gerhardt, professor of constitutional law at the University of North Carolina School of Law and the National Constitution Center’s scholar-in-residence interviews Mary Sarah Bilder, professor of law, distinguished scholar and author of  James Madison's 'Notes': Revising the Constitutional Convention.
